    Company description:

    KOB-TV Channel 4, New Mexico's first television station, initially began as the mere vision of Tom Pepperday, owner of KOB Radio. (KOB-TV is no longer affiliated with the radio stations.) In 1943 Pepperday applied for and was denied a television license. He reapplied in 1948 and his persistence paid off. He was granted a license and in the process made history. KOB-TV became the first television station between the Mississippi River and the West Coast.

    Company description:

    The Daily Times is a multimedia news and information source, offering complete online information for the Four Corners area, including Farmington, Aztec, Bloomfield, and the Navajo Nation. The Daily Times includes print, mobile, niche publications, an outstanding website, blogs, social media networking, and customized content to meet the specific needs of its readers and advertisers. It was first published in 1888 and is based in Farmington, N.M.
